Introduction of CAS:947141-86-8 | trans-1-(Boc-aMino)-4-ethynylcyclohexane, 97%

 

The molecular structure of "tert-Butyl trans-4-ethynylcyclohexylcarbamate" is defined by its molecular formula, C13H21NO2 . It has an average mass of 223.311 Da and a monoisotopic mass of 223.157227 Da.

 

The physical and chemical properties of "tert-Butyl trans-4-ethynylcyclohexylcarbamate" include a density of 1.0±0.1 g/cm3, a boiling point of 312.9±22.0 °C at 760 mmHg, and a vapor pressure of 0.0±0.7 mmHg at 25°C . It has an enthalpy of vaporization of 55.4±3.0 kJ/mol and a flash point of 143.0±22.3 °C . The compound has a molar refractivity of 63.5±0.4 cm3.
